    Your role in the team

    • Pipeline Engineering: Build, deploy, and maintain robust transformation pipelines for high-volume data. You will participate in the full lifecycle: ingestion, transformation, testing (unit/integration), deployment, and monitoring.
    • Optimization & Maintenance: Write highly efficient code and collaborate with the team to refactor legacy systems, helping to improve performance and reduce cloud compute costs (e.g., optimizing Athena/Snowflake/Redshift clustering or AWS Glue jobs).
    • Software Engineering Best Practices: Adhere to and promote the team's technical standards by actively utilizing CI/CD workflows, containerization (Docker), and automated testing.
    • Data Quality & Observability: Focus on infrastructure monitoring rather than just business dashboards. You will implement alerts and checks (e.g., dbt tests, Great Expectations) to catch data quality issues before they reach stakeholders.
    • Collaboration & Growth: Work closely with Senior Engineers to plan architectures, participate actively in code reviews, and advocate for engineering rigor within the squad.

    Our expectations of you

    Qualifications

    • We are looking for a Data Analytics Engineer who approaches data with a software engineering mindset. You will join our Data Solutions squad to build and maintain production-grade data platforms.
    • This is not a Data Analyst role. While you will understand the business context, your primary focus is technical: building scalable workflows, writing clean and testable Python/SQL code, automating deployments, and supporting cloud infrastructure optimizations.
    • Must-Have Skills:
    • Solid Python proficiency: You write modular, object-oriented code, utilize relevant libraries for testing, and understand exception handling and logging.
    • Strong skills in SQL & dbt: You can build scalable data models (Jinja templating, macros, incremental strategies) and understand query execution plans.
    • Data Warehouse Ops: Solid understanding of warehousing architecture (Snowflake, Redshift, or BigQuery), including partitioning and clustering concepts.

    Experience

    • We are looking for a candidate who has solid analytics engineering experience or a strong background in backend development focused on data.
    • 2+ years of experience specifically in Analytics Engineering or Data Engineering.
    • Software Engineering Fundamentals: Practical experience with Git flows, CI/CD pipelines (e.g., GitHub Actions, GitLab CI), and Containerization (Docker).
    • AWS Cloud Native Experience: Experience building and maintaining data workflows using serverless architectures such as AWS Lambda, StepFunctions, Glue, and Athena.
    • Testing Mindset: Experience implementing Unit Tests and Integration Tests for data pipelines rather than relying solely on manual checks.
